Definition:
The verb "automate" means to make a process or a task automatic. This means that a machine or a computer does the work instead of a person. For example, when we automate a task, it can be done without needing manual effort every time.
In more complex contexts, "automate" can also refer to the use of artificial intelligence or advanced software systems that learn and improve over time.
While "automate" primarily refers to making processes automatic, in different contexts, it can imply simplifying or streamlining tasks.
There are no direct idioms or phrasal verbs specifically for "automate," but you might see related phrases like: - "Run on autopilot": This means something is functioning automatically without needing much attention, similar to how "automate" works. - Example: "Since we automated the process, it now runs on autopilot."
